Honda CB500X About

The Honda CB500X is a versatile adventure bike that combines performance, comfort, and style. It is powered by a 471cc liquid-cooled, parallel-twin engine that delivers a smooth and responsive ride. The bike features a comfortable upright riding position, long-travel suspension, and a rugged chassis that can handle a variety of terrains, from paved roads to dirt trails.

In terms of technology, the CB500X boasts a digital LCD instrument cluster that provides riders with vital information such as speed, fuel level, and gear position. The bike also comes with LED lighting, adjustable brake and clutch levers, and a slipper clutch for smooth gear changes.

One of the key selling points of the CB500X is its versatility. The bike is suitable for a wide range of riders, from beginners to experienced riders looking for a reliable and comfortable adventure bike. It can handle long-distance touring, daily commuting, and off-road adventures with ease.

Honda CB500X Mileage

The mileage (fuel efficiency) of the Honda CB500X can vary depending on factors such as riding style, road conditions, and maintenance. CB500X has a fuel tank capacity of 4.6 gallons (17.4 liters) and an estimated fuel economy of 61 miles per gallon (25.9 kilometers per liter) in combined city and highway riding.

This means that the CB500X can potentially travel up to approximately 280 miles (450 kilometers) on a full tank of gas. However, actual mileage may vary depending on factors such as riding conditions and habits. Honda CB500X Specs

Here are the specifications for the 2023 Honda CB500X:

  1. Engine: 471cc liquid-cooled, parallel-twin engine
  2. Power: 47 horsepower @ 8,500 rpm
  3. Torque: 31 lb-ft @ 6,500 rpm
  4. Transmission: 6-speed manual
  5. Fuel System: Fuel-injection system
  6. Suspension: 41mm telescopic fork (front) and Pro-Link single shock with nine-position spring preload adjustability (rear)
  7. Brakes: Dual-piston caliper with single 310mm disc (front) and single-piston caliper with single 240mm disc (rear), with optional ABS
  8. Tires: 120/70ZR17 front, 160/60ZR17 rear
  9. Wheelbase: 55.9 inches
  10. Seat height: 32.7 inches
  11. Fuel capacity: 4.6 gallons
  12. Curb weight: 430 pounds (standard model)
